Fulton County, Georgia Population By Race and Ethnicity in 2021 (ACS-5Yrs)
Based on the US Census ACS-5Yrs estimates, in 2021, the total Fulton County, GA population was 1,054,286. The Black or African American Alone racial group had the highest population (458.49K) and constituted 43.49% of the total Fulton County population. The White Alone racial group had the second highest population (447.84K) and constituted 42.48% of the population. The third highest racial group was Asian Alone (78.94K), constituting 7.49% of the population.
The population of the Non-Hispanic White Alone ethnicity group was 410.62K and constituted 38.95% of the population. The population of the Hispanic or Latino of All Races ethnicity group was (76.17K) and constituted 7.23% of the population.

| Race | Population | % of Total Pop. |
|---|---|---|
| Black or African American Alone | 458490 | 43.49 |
| White Alone | 447842 | 42.48 |
| Asian Alone | 78942 | 7.49 |
| Two Or More Races | 42047 | 3.99 |
| Some Other Race Alone | 24134 | 2.29 |
| American Indian and Alaska Native Alone | 2520 | 0.24 |
| Native Hawaiian And Pacific Islander Alone | 311 | 0.03 |
| Ethnicity | Population | % of Total Pop. |
|---|---|---|
| Non-Hispanic White Alone | 410620 | 38.95 |
| Hispanic or Latino of All Races | 76168 | 7.23 |
